A long time ago I put the following two lines in my .Xresources file
to give Emacs a nicer color scheme (in my opinion).  

! Set the modeline colors.
Emacs.modeline*attributeForeground:     Black
Emacs.modeline*attributeBackground:     AntiqueWhite1

Some time ago, maybe even years ago, they stopped working, and I just
now decided I'd try to figure out what was going on.  I used "editres"
to try to figure out what X resource I should be setting, thinking
that the name had changed.  However, I couldn't find anything that
looked like the right thing.

Is this even how this is done anymore?  I'm running Emacs 21.2 on OS X
10.4, built for X11 (obviously), not Carbon.
